Memorial Health System’s Selby General Hospital Celebrates National Recognition for Cleanliness

Memorial Health System is proud to announce Selby General Hospital’s recent recognition of a 5-star cleanliness rating based on patient survey feedback from the Hospital Consumer Assessment of Healthcare Providers and Systems (HCAHPS).

A national, standardized survey distributed by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S), HCAHPS gathers feedback from patients concerning their recent inpatient hospital stay. Based on their responses, the data is then compiled and released by CMS as part of their Hospital Care Compare Program, which publicly shares information about the quality of care across hospitals in the United States.

Selby General Hospital earned a 5-star rating specifically for cleanliness, reflecting patients’ confidence in the hospital’s environment, safety standards, and commitment to infection prevention. This recognition places them among the top-performing hospitals nationwide in this important aspect of patient care and further highlights Memorial Health System’s dedication to providing exceptional patient care.

“This award is such an honor, and my staff and I are overwhelmed with joy and excitement that we made this list,” shares Selby General Hospital Environmental Services supervisor, Kelly Allen. “My staff understand the importance of their job duties and that they are the front line for infection control. They understand that this rating comes from Patient Satisfaction Surveys, which means that their hard work and attention to detail don’t go unnoticed—it takes all of us to keep the hospital flowing and operational.”
